I have a jackplate that was manufactured by CMC and I believe the model is power lift. I do not know anything about these and it is not hooked up how do I wire this thing up?

What do you mean its not hooked up? I have a cmc tilt and it came with its own built in wiring harness. Just hook to battery and put switch where you want. If you have no wiring then you have big problems as there are many wires with this system.
